Details
A vulnerability was found in Microsoft Windows 2000/Server 2003/XP (Operating System) and classified as critical. Affected by this issue is an unknown code in the library gdi32.dll of the component WMF File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a denial of service vulnerability. Using CWE to declare the problem leads to CWE-404. The product does not release or incorrectly releases a resource before it is made available for re-use. Impacted is availability. CVE summarizes:
Sign extension vulnerability in the createBrushIndirect function in the GDI library (gdi32.dll) in Microsoft Windows XP, Server 2003, and possibly other versions, allows user-assisted att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) via a crafted WMF file.
The issue has been introduced in 02/17/2000. The weakness was released 08/07/2006 by cyanid-E (Website). The advisory is available at lists.grok.org.uk. This vulnerability is handled as CVE-2006-4071 since 08/09/2006. The attack needs to be initiated within the local network. No form of authentication is required for exploitation. Technical details as well as a public exploit are known.
A public exploit has been developed by cyanid-E and been published 6 months after the advisory. The exploit is available at lists.grok.org.uk. It is declared as proof-of-concept. The vulnerability was handled as a non-public zero-day exploit for at least 2363 days. During that time the estimated underground price was around $25k-$100k.
Upgrading eliminates this vulnerability. Applying a patch is able to eliminate this problem. The bugfix is ready for download at windowsupdate.microsoft.com. The best possible mitigation is suggested to be upgrading to the latest version. Attack attempts may be identified with Snort ID 10115. In this case the pattern |FC 02| is used for detection.
The vulnerability is also documented in the databases at X-Force (28281), Exploit-DB (3111), SecurityFocus (BID 21992†), OSVDB (27797†) and Secunia (SA21377†).
